Understanding Dental Care Cost: An Essential Breakdown
Before exploring ways to reduce dental care cost, it is vital to understand the factors that influence the overall expenses associated with dental treatments. Dental care cost varies widely based on multiple elements, including geographic location, the complexity of the procedure, technology used, and the expertise of dental professionals involved.
Key Factors Impacting Dental Care Cost
- Type of Procedure: From routine cleaning to intricate root canals or dental implants, each procedure has a different price point.
- Geographic Location: Dental costs in developed countries tend to be higher due to operational expenses, whereas countries with advanced healthcare infrastructure abroad often offer more affordable options.
- Materials and Technology: The use of premium materials such as zirconia or porcelain can influence material costs, and cutting-edge technology like digital imaging or laser dentistry can impact the overall price.
- Practitioner’s Expertise: Experienced specialists with specialized training generally charge higher fees, but their expertise can lead to better outcomes and fewer complications.
- Facilities and Equipment: State-of-the-art clinics invest heavily in infrastructure, which reflects on the treatment cost but ensures safety and precision.

1. Prioritize Preventive Care
Regular checkups and professional cleanings are cost-effective measures that prevent more severe and costly dental issues down the line. Early detection of cavities or gum disease can save significantly on invasive procedures later.

3. Assess Clinic Credentials & Patient Reviews
When considering options outside your home country, prioritize clinics that are accredited by reputable organizations such as the Joint Commission International (JCI). Reading previous patient reviews helps ensure quality service while avoiding hidden costs or subpar results.

Comparative Analysis: Domestic vs. International Dental Care Cost
One of the core concerns for patients is whether they will get better value by choosing local dental services or exploring treatment abroad. Here’s a comparative review:
Domestic Dental Care Cost: The Typical Scenario
In countries like the United States, Canada, or across Western Europe, the dental care cost for procedures such as crowns, implants, or braces can be astronomical. A single dental implant, for example, may cost between $3,000 to $6,000, depending on the region and complexity.
International Dental Care Cost: Unlocking Affordability
Conversely, many patients find that similar procedures abroad at certified clinics can reduce costs by up to 70%. For example, a dental implant could range from $1,200 to $2,500 in countries like Turkey or Hungary, all while maintaining high standards of care.
High-Quality Dental Care Abroad: How to Ensure You Receive the Best Service
Lower dental care cost should not compromise quality. To ensure that you receive the desired outcome, consider these critical factors:
- Clinic Certification: Choose clinics accredited by international organizations to guarantee adherence to global standards.
- Qualified Practitioners: Verify the credentials, experience, and specialization of your chosen dentist.
- Modern Technology: Confirm the use of state-of-the-art equipment and materials that promise durability and aesthetics.
- Patient Testimonials & Before & After Photos: Review real patient experiences and outcomes to gauge consistency and quality of treatments.
- Post-Treatment Support: Ensure that the clinic offers follow-up care and guarantees regarding the longevity of the results.
